Greetings from NC, guys.

It’s been about a 40 year hiatus since I owned an early 80’s KZ750. A bit of a story but I was ultimately smitten by Ducati’s back in the early 90’s and didn’t look back until this past summer on a trip up to the North East. While out on a bike ride (the pedal type) I noticed a couple of bikes heading in my direction and before they even got to me… that sound… I know that sound! Sure enough a pair of LTD 1k’s went by in the other direction. Returned back home and the search was on. It was not at all what I had in mind but I came across an 1980 Z1-Classic with 1,253 original miles on it. Personally, I think the bike was the right idea (fuel injection) but it was cursed by poor execution. So… the plan is to simply turn it into a conventional 1000 LTD. The bike I couldn’t afford back in the day. Fuel injection is pulled and now I am focusing on turning it into an 80 LTD. I hope it will be a straight forward project but I am sure I will run into some gremlins along the way. If so, I hope I may be able to lean on some of you to provide a bit of adult supervision.

Welcome to KZR...you are going the route of many owners of the KZ1000G model...switching to CV carbs.  Did you try and run the bike with the original FI?  Don't discard the FI system as if you ever decide to move on from the G model, the original FI system will be an added value for resale.
